Output 868afbec7ea4b08044eb1731f25f6f01f24d059d4e83deb4ed7a8b42913311e8:0

value
64222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 728055a789a44c882b02c9d29accb333bad23917 OP_EQUAL
address
3C8ShFo61XHhjq3aZDQyodpUL2on8NyT3i
transaction
868afbec7ea4b08044eb1731f25f6f01f24d059d4e83deb4ed7a8b42913311e8
spent
true